About Gordon Sargent

Gordon Sargent was born in 2004 in Birmingham, Alabama, USA. He started playing golf at a young age and was introduced to the sport by his father, Seth Sargent, a former amateur golfer and a vice president at Hoar Construction.

Sargent attended Mountain Brook High School and graduated in 2021. He was a standout golfer in high school and won several tournaments, including the Alabama State Junior Championship in 2019 and the AJGA Simplify Boys Championship at Carlton Woods in 2020.

Sargent joined Vanderbilt University in 2021 and became a star player for the Commodores. He won four college tournaments in his freshman season. He also won the individual stroke-play title in the East Lake Cup and finished in the top five 11 times in his first two seasons.

Sargent also represented the United States in international competitions, such as the Arnold Palmer Cup in Switzerland and the Eisenhower Trophy in France. He became the No. 1 ranked amateur golfer in the world in February of 2023. He received a special invitation to play in the Masters Tournament in 2023, becoming the first amateur to do so since Aaron Baddeley in 2000.
